King Global continues drilling at Iron Horse target

2026-08-12 23:08 ET - News Release

Mr. Robert Dzisiak reports

KING CONTINUES TO ADVANCE ARIZONA EXPLORATION PROGRAM AS U.S. MOVES TO EXPAND DOMESTIC MINING WORKFORDE

King Global Ventures Inc. continues exploration work at its Black Canyon/Silver Cord project near Cleator, Ariz., as federal policy shifts toward rebuilding America's domestic mining work force and supply chains.

On Aug. 7, 2026, the White House announced that the U.S. Department of Energy is investing $100-million into the country's 14 mining schools to double the number of graduates earning mining, minerals and supply chain credentials, part of a broader package exceeding $2-billion in new mining and mining related investments, and over $180-million in mining school and work force funding announced the same day. The announcement followed a historic White House roundtable with mining industry leaders -- described by the administration as the largest meeting of its kind between industry leaders and a sitting president in over 120 years.

Domestic exploration companies with active U.S. projects, particularly those targeting critical and strategic minerals, such as antimony, stand to benefit from a policy environment increasingly focused on expanding the domestic work force and supply chain needed to bring new deposits into production.

King Global is advancing a 14,000-foot diamond drill program at the Iron Horse target within the Black Canyon project to test priority geophysical anomalies for their potential to represent VMS-style (volcanogenic massive sulphide) sulphide mineralization within the Lower Spud Mountain formation. Drilling and continuing geological and XRF interpretation have identified prospective volcanic stratigraphy, hydrothermal alteration, feeder-style geochemical responses and multiple marker horizons, while wedge drilling from IH-26-03 is being used to further test the target at depth. The program remains at an exploration stage and is intended to determine the geological source of the geophysical anomalies and assess whether they are associated with a potentially mineralized VMS-style hydrothermal system. Previous drilling included the Silver Cord, completed in December, 2025, encountered high-grade polymetallic veins containing silver, gold, lead, zinc and antimony, including a highlight interval of nine feet (2.7 metres) grading 619.6 grams per tonne (g/t) (21.8 ounces per ton (oz/t)) silver, 1.0 g/t gold, 0.6 per cent lead, 1.05 per cent zinc and 375 g/t antimony (see King Global news release dated Dec. 2, 2025).

Qualified person statement (National Instrument 43-101)

The scientific and technical information contained in this news release has been reviewed and approved by Andrew Lee Smith, PGeo, ICD.D, who is a qualified person as defined by National Instrument 43-101, Standards of Disclosure for Mineral Projects. Mr. Smith is consultant to King Global Ventures and is independent of the company for the purposes of NI 43-101.

In verifying the scientific and technical information contained in this release, the qualified person conducted a comprehensive review of all available analytical data, geological logs, drill core photographs and supporting documentation generated during the 2025 Silver Cord drill program. This verification work included confirmation of the sampling procedures used in the field, an assessment of chain-of-custody protocols and evaluation of the security measures implemented to ensure sample integrity from the drill site to the laboratory.

As part of his review, the qualified person examined King Global's QA/QC (quality assurance/quality control) program, including the insertion of certified reference standards, blanks and duplicate samples into the analytical stream. He also verified that no material QA/QC issues were identified that would affect the reliability of the assay results. In addition, the qualified person reviewed original assay certificates issued by ALS Geochemistry, an independent laboratory accredited to ISO/IEC 17025:2017 standards, and confirmed that the analytical methods applied, including multielement ICP-MS (inductively coupled plasma mass spectrometry), ICP-AES (inductively coupled plasma atomic emission spectroscopy) and appropriate overlimit reanalysis -- are suitable for the style of mineralization encountered at Silver Cord.

The qualified person further confirmed that the geological interpretations presented in this release, including references to structural controls, alteration patterns (AI/CCPI), metal zonation and evidence for multiple phases of hydrothermal mineralization, are consistent with the observed drill core, surface mapping, geochemical signatures and assay data. These interpretations are presented as conceptual geological models based on current drilling and are supported by the data available at this stage of exploration

About King Global Ventures Inc.

King Global Ventures is focused on the exploration of precious and base metals in North America. The Black Canyon project in Yavapai county, Arizona, comprises 213 contiguous concessions covering a total area of 4,000 acres encompassing 15 formerly operating mines, including the past-producing Howard copper mine. The Black Canyon project is situated 100 kilometres (62 miles) north of Phoenix, Ariz., and represents an early-stage exploration opportunity targeting copper-gold-silver-zinc, volcanogenic massive sulphide (VMS) mineralization. The geology of Yavapai county, Arizona, is notable due to the presence of a variety of base and precious metal deposit types. The region has a significant history of exploration, discovery and mining operations, including base metals from mining operations like Bagdad, Jerome and Cleopatra. The property is on trend and is approximately 13 kilometres (eight miles) northwest of Arizona Metals Corp.

The Howard copper mine property is located on 78 acres of patented land. Discovered in the early 1920s, small-scale production and development focused on high-grade copper. Historical reports state that the main shaft was sunk to the 900-foot level but that no ore was mined below the 500-foot level.

The Mikwam gold property is located in Noseworthy township within the Abitibi greenstone belt of the Superior province in Northeastern Ontario. It lies along the Casa Berardi deformation zone, which hosts Detour Gold's Burntbush property. The Mikwam property is hosted within Timiskaming-aged polymictic conglomerate and greywacke units, and contains disseminated and vein-hosted gold mineralization associated with quartz-carbonate veins and pyrite mineralization.
